Type
ORACLE
Validation date
2024-07-19 05: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01792,
    "usd": 0.01951
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001DB2038C46ADC4F66278AB1263C83BB8BF968D1653367AC48657561019E15F609

Previous signature

65ECF8F5C8ECD9F58888E94BA0FA91DA989D31DE701A6B0D0A4DAC92F373C363FB17907D6819EB363C67B3127D683AD28566EF8CF2B64D5193193BB585DC670D

Origin signature

3045022063AAD27FD59A55D670B06846E8EBE2C0A52D4DE26723DCBAEDB8B8701D38C61B022100B6F74FEBC42E981C842C5C758E71C87F0B4C72A91E2D394CA5E0E4E8A4273EE2

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00C2C83905A11E67BEDD5BA2822F9C730B2E1E4CD86600E524A3585E80136876DF

Coordinator signature

784FC7A17C677DEE951FB10C3DB9AA256F6225BBCF39A03A794A07D50AAF9EF73F93698C48D68944833DEE94F9ABB980BF5C8F8967D89011AFC74AA4A61ABE06

Validator #1 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#1 signature

1CF23779D58190EB7A28EE05E3C4D8499E189EEB8FDCE49A0A9EB243DD4BF8537B5FBC4165002B68D9FD7D3EA2153D2A93455469019973BD2D8CC08167900501

Validator #2 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#2 signature

5E88D64FC54D1D8C87085F4243A70CCD28A0B6754C717D5EE052FEA5C00D14BBBD32207E92BC87228B49CA6319190870CF1416CD3D26BD2A389AEA2D8AE9A307